Abstracts

English Abstract

A flame adjusting device includes a tank for receiving a fluid and includes an upper portion and a lower portion coupled to a coupler with hoses. The coupler is coupled to a gas generator. A control device is disposed between the coupler and an upper hose and is used for controlling the gas to flow through the hoses and to adjust the gas flowing out of the tank. The gas is a gaseous fuel and is supplied to a facility for generating a flame. The temperature generated by the flame may thus also be adjusted.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T
Referring to the drawings, and initially to FIGS. 1-3, a flame adjusting

device in accordance with the present invention is provided and coupled to
a nozzle 12 of an oxygen and hydrogen generator 11 for receiving the

5 gaseous fuel, such as the oxygen and/or the hydrogen. One example of the
oxygen and hydrogen generator 11 is disclosed in U.S. Patent No.
6,068,741 to Lin issued on May 30, 2000 and is taken as a reference for the
present invention. The flame adjusting device andlor the oxygen and
hydrogen generator 11 may be disposed in a housing 10 or the like.

The flame adjusting device comprises a tank 20 including a port 21
for adding into or for drawing a fluid 28 from the tank 20 and including an
indicator 23 coupled to the side portion for indicating the fluid 28 level in
the tank 20. The fluid 28 may be selected from gasoline, alcohol, alkyl
group, or alcoholic fluids, etc. Two hoses 40, 50, couple the lower and the

upper portions of the tank 20 to a coupler 30, such as a three-way valve,
and a control valve 51 is provided between the coupler 30 and the hose 50
for controlling the gaseous fuel through the hoses 40, 50. The tank 20
includes an outlet 22 for supplying the gaseous fuel out to a facility, such
as
a torch 24 (FIG. 1) and for generating a flame to conduct a welding or

cutting process. It


CA 02309490 2000-05-26
6

is preferable that the hose 50 is coupled to the tank 20 at a position lower
than
the outlet 22.

In operation, as shown in FIG.3, the control valve 51 may control the
gaseous fuel to flow to the facility 24 through the hose 50 and the outlet 22
only. The gaseous fuel may generate a flame of a temperature up to 3000 C,

depending on the gaseous fuel generated by the generator 11. As shown in
FIG.4, the control valve 51 may control the gaseous fuel to flow to the
facility
24 through the hose 40 and the fluid 28 only. The gaseous fuel may be mixed
with the fluid 28 to form a mixed gas which generate a flame of a temperature

about 900 C, depending on the gaseous fuel and the fluid 28. As shown in
FIG. 5, the control valve 51 may control the gaseous fuel to flow to the
facility
24 through the hose 40 and the fluid 28 and the hose 50 separately. A portion
of the gaseous fuel may be mixed with the fluid 28 to form a mixed gas which
generate a flame of a temperature ranging from 900 C to 3000 C, depending
on the gaseous fuel and the fluid 28 and depending on the gaseous fuel

flowing through the hoses 40, 50.

Accordingly, the flame adjusting device in accordance with the present
invention may be used for adjusting the gaseous fuel from the oxygen and
hydrogen generator and may be used to adjust the flame generated by the
gaseous fuel.
